Improper Neutralization of CRLF Sequences in HTTP Headers in Jooby ('HTTP Response Splitting)
Impact - Cross Site Scripting - Cache Poisoning - Page Hijacking Patches This was fixed in version 2.2.1. Workarounds If you are unable to update, ensure that user supplied data isn't able to flow to HTTP headers. If it does, pre-sanitize for CRLF characters. References CWE-113: Improper...

Authentication flaw
For ABB eSOMS versions 4.0 to 6.0.2, the X-Frame-Options header is not configured in HTTP response. This can potentially allow 'ClickJacking' attacks where an attacker can frame parts of the application on a malicious web site, revealing sensitive user information such as authentication credentia...
